Please note that this role is a parental cover. Sitting within the European Regional Media Team and working across the Mars Snacking portfolio, the Addressable Media Manager will be responsible for creating growth audiences for brand media execution, working on data‑driven targeting strategies specific to regional brand audiences in partnership with the regional media team, our Digital hub and internal/external data partners.

What will be your key responsibilities?

  • Co‑create with brand and content teams on the development and delivery of actionable audience strategies using a mix of 1st, 2nd and 3rd party data sets – this will be required per brand, market and channel.
  • Develop a POV on best practices for data diversity and the future of data‑driven marketing.
  • Drive the OESP Media Capability Program.
  • Be accountable for compelling action‑led audience planning tests, which will fuel our learning in this area.
  • Continue to develop knowledge of the audience data landscape across Europe, including changes in privacy legislation that will impact data‑driven marketing: keep aware of changes in the industry – including legislative, OEM or publisher‑driven changes that could impact our future marketing strategy.
  • Be accountable for audience hypothesis testing & experiments, which will fuel our learning in this area.
  • Manage the test and learn program.
  • Lead the regional inputs for our Global JBPs.

What Are We Looking For

  • Excellent project management skills.
  • Ability to influence and collaborate with stakeholder groups across different geographies.
  • Proven financial acumen and commercial know-how.
  • Proven experience in either in‑house or agency settings.
  • Proven audience planning leadership to drive change across the European organization.
  • A passion for data‑driven communications and continuous learning.
